      Cobalt^(60) 照射가 保存血에 미치는 影響 = (The) effects of cobalt^(60) irradiation on stored blood

      Since radicactive substances are widely used in various field. There are increased chances in human being after accidental exposure to irradiation are extensively studied, but there are few available informations upon stored blood exposed to irradiation.
      It is an interesting matter to know what changes are manifasted in irradiated stored blood.
      Author studied erythrocyte, leucocyte, platelst count and hematocrit determdnation in irradiated stored blood exposed to 500r, 1000r, 2500r, and 5000r with cobalt.
      The analyses of the bloods are made in 1st(24 hours), 7th. 14th and 21st day after irradiation and results obtained are as follows:
      1. By duration of storage, erythrocyte count of none radiated stored blood(Control blood) showed a slight decrease, whereas irradiated bloods showed slightly lower count than that of control blood. The decreasing ratio of control to irradiated bloods in 1st, 7th, 14th and 21st day manifest roughly same ratio. There are no significant differences of erythrocyte count acoording to domage of radiation.
      2. Leucocyte count of the control blood showed gradually and moderately decreasing number with duration of storage. There are no significant differences of count in irradiated blood and control blood and also no significant difference of count by dosage of irradiation.
      3. Platelet count of the control blood showed marked decrease by duration of storage and in irradiated blood, but there are no noticeable differences of count by dosage of irradiation.
      4. There are no noticeable differences of hematocrit in control groups and also alteration of hematocrit in irradiated blood group.
